    KTM 250 Duke vs Royal Enfield Himalayan 440

    Should you buy KTM 250 Duke or Royal Enfield Himalayan 440 Find out which bike is best for you - compare the two models on the basis of their price, mileage, features, colours and other specs. KTM 250 Duke price in is Rs 2,26,767 (ex-showroom price) whereas the Royal Enfield Himalayan 440 price in is Rs 2,29,900 (ex-showroom). The engine in the 250 Duke makes 31 PS and 25 Nm . On the other hand, the power and torque of Himalayan 440 stand at 25.42 PS and 34 Nm respectively. KTM offers the 250 Duke in 3 colours whereas the Royal Enfield Himalayan 440 comes in 3 colours. Out of 2 user reviews, Himalayan 440 scores 4.7 whereas the KTM 250 Duke tallies 4.5 out of 5 based on 154 user reviews..
